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 удаление из массива структуры https://www.cyberforum.ru/ cpp-beginners/ thread881003.html
Не могу написать функцию которая удаляла бы из массива определенную структуру, а затем измененный массив записывала в файл. struct worker { char name ; char initials; int gdate; char obr; char spec; int pdate; char ndate;
C++ Исключения потоков
У меня такой вопрос, как можно обработать исключение, если к примеру не получается открыть файл. То есть я делаю так: file.clear(); // очистить биты file.exceptions(ios_base::failbit); try { file.open(filename); } catch(ios_base::failure) {
C++ C++: Шаблон – двоичный файл, содержащий двусвязный циклический список объектов Пытался разобраться в данном вопросе самостоятельно, но в связи с неминуемо приблидающейся сессией пришло понимание что мне нужна помощь. Пожалуйста помогите решить задачу. Общее задание Шаблон - структура данных в двоичном файле. Класс двоичного файла, производный от fstream. Двоичный файл содержит заданную структуру данных с типом хранимых объектов - параметром шаблона. Программа должна... https://www.cyberforum.ru/ cpp-beginners/ thread880974.html C++ Какой это язык https://www.cyberforum.ru/ cpp-beginners/ thread880971.html
Доброго времени суток. Прошу прощения, но хочу уточнить какой это язык и есть ли вообще это языком программирования?(это из книги William H. Press 'Numerical Recipes') Прошу прощения,что имеется только скрин!
C++ Как в С++ задать функцию таблично и построить интерполяционный многочлен Лагранжа?
Нужно последовательно ввести значения аргументов с нулевого по третий и значения функции в этих точках, а затем применить формулу http://i5.imageban.ru/out/2013/05/27/737c79391209cfb3d9cc5ea011ec638f.png при http://i2.imageban.ru/out/2013/05/27/30de18d35de949f7dda390c57aeba1cf.png То есть построить интерполяционный многочлен Лагранжа третьей степени. Как это сделать?
C++ Написать программу подсчета числа вершин (левых, правых) в бинарном дереве https://www.cyberforum.ru/ cpp-beginners/ thread880955.html
помогите пожалуйста вот с такой задачей(( 1. Написать программу подсчета числа вершин в бинарном дереве 2. Написать программу подсчета левых вершин бинарного дерева 3. Написать программу подсчета правых вершин бинарного дерева
C++ Используя высокоуровневые функции работы с файлами, прочитать строку из файла Здравствуйте! Очень нужна помощь... В этом задании нужно с помощью свой лично написанной функции избавиться от лишних пробелов и с помощью стандартной функции revers "перевернуть" строку. // 2.Используя высокоуровневые функции работы с файлами, прочитать строку из файла, // состоящую из английских слов, разделёнными пробелами (одним или несколько). Вывести строку, // содержащую эти же... https://www.cyberforum.ru/ cpp-beginners/ thread880950.html Переключение контекста потоков C++
Подскажите код программы на с++, которая реализует переключение контекста потоков.
C++ Функция разбивает строку на две части: до первого вхождения заданного символа и после него Программу написал но не очень понятно как без цстринг (а это в условии, что нельзя пользоваться cstring). В самоучителе про цстринг написано и вот что с ним получилось у меня. а надо без него. короче хз как делать. подскажите #include <string> #include <iostream> using namespace std; int main() { string s1; char ch; https://www.cyberforum.ru/ cpp-beginners/ thread880920.html C++ Списки (в какой папке должен находится cpp файл) #include<fstream> #include<string> using namespace std; #include"list1.cpp" ifstream in("input.txt"); ofstream out("output.txt"); int main() { List<int>I; int value; https://www.cyberforum.ru/ cpp-beginners/ thread880918.html
Почему программа не работает и выдает ошибки? C++
Здравствуйте! У меня программа выдает следующие ошибки: 1. vcl.h: No such file or directory. 2. In function `int main()': 3. 37 `strcmp' undeclared (first use this function) 4. (Each undeclared identifier is reported only once for each function it appears in.) Что не так в программе и как это исправить? вот код программы: #include <vcl.h>
C++ Построить и записать алгоритм определения судейской оценки на спортивных соревнованиях Построить и записать алгоритм определения судейской оценки на спортивных соревнованиях. Необходимо из N выставленных оценок отбросить минимальную и максимальную и усреднить оставшиеся оценки не могу разобраться как делать, нужно написать алгоритм для программы на си++ для borland https://www.cyberforum.ru/ cpp-beginners/ thread880904.html
415 / 411 / 95
Регистрация: 06.10.2011
Сообщений: 832
27.05.2013, 21:41 0

Ввести двумерный массив 4*4, подсчитать кол-во (+) и (-) элементов и вывести статистику по строкам, сколько (+), сколько (-) и подсчитать общую сумму - C++ - Ответ 4626555

27.05.2013, 21:41. Показов 1048. Ответов 12
Метки (Все метки)

Ответ

К сожалению не подскажу потому, что не пользуюсь таким инструментом. В интернетах пишут, что она включена по умолчанию.
Попробуйте так (убрал greater):
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#include <iostream>
#include <vector>
#include <algorithm>
#include <iomanip>
#include <random>
#include <chrono>
 
using namespace std;
 
typedef int type;
typedef vector<type> one_dimension;
typedef vector<one_dimension> two_dimension;
 
int main()
{
    default_random_engine gen(chrono::system_clock::now().time_since_epoch().count());
    uniform_int_distribution<type> distribution(-99, 99);
    const one_dimension::size_type rows = 4, cols = 4;
    two_dimension vec(rows, one_dimension(cols));
    for (auto &v : vec )
        generate( begin(v), end(v), [&]{ return distribution(gen); } );
 
    type overall_sum = 0;
 
    for (auto &v : vec) {
        for (auto &x : v) cout << setw(4) << x;
        auto positive_count = count_if( begin(v), end(v), [](type x) { return x > 0; } );
        cout << fixed << setprecision(1);
        cout << " (+)" << setw(5) << positive_count * 100 / static_cast<double>(cols) << "%,"
             << " (-)" << setw(5) << 100.0 - positive_count * 100 / static_cast<double>(cols) << "%" << endl;
        overall_sum = accumulate( begin(v), end(v), overall_sum, [](type x, type y) { return x + y; } );
        cout << fixed << setprecision(0);
    }
    cout << "Overall sum = " << overall_sum;
 
    return 0;
}


Вернуться к обсуждению:
Ввести двумерный массив 4*4, подсчитать кол-во (+) и (-) элементов и вывести статистику по строкам, сколько (+), сколько (-) и подсчитать общую сумму C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
27.05.2013, 21:41
Готовые ответы и решения:

Ввести массив А(10), подсчитать сколько в нем четных, сколько нечетных элементов
2. Ввести массив А(10), подсчитать сколько в нем четных, сколько нечетных элементов.

Ввести с клавиатуры двумерный массив из 9 чисел, подсчитать сумму элементов всего массива
Ввести с клавиатуры двумерный массив из 9 чисел, подсчитать сумму элементов всего массива

Ввести с клавиатуры двумерный массив из 9 чисел, подсчитать сумму элементов третьего столбца
Ввести с клавиатуры двумерный массив из 9 чисел, подсчитать сумму элементов третьего столбца.

Случайным образом генерируется двумерный массив, подсчитать сумму по строкам
Задача: Случаным образом генерируется двумерный массив в dataGridView(в этом основной вопрос),...

12
27.05.2013, 21:41
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
27.05.2013, 21:41
Помогаю со студенческими работами здесь

Ввести линейный целочисленный массив до 50 элементов,подсчитать сумму четных элементов,вывести элементы находящиеся в заданном диапазоне
Ввести линейный целочисленный массив до 50 элементов,подсчитать сумму четных элементов,вывести...

Ввести целочисленный двумерный массив AN×N , вывести его. Определить K – сколько нечётных элементов содержится на диагоналях массива.
Ввести целочисленный двумерный массив AN×N , вывести его. Определить K – сколько нечётных элементов...

Массив: Подсчитать сумму некратных 3 элементов по строкам полученной матрицы
Нуждаюсь в помощи! Нужно Создать приложение, которое по введенной количества строк и столбцов...

Ввести строку. Подсчитать сколько раз в ней встречаются строчные и сколько раз заглавные русские буквы
Всем привет. Очень хотелось бы что бы помогли с решением данной задачи. Ввести строку. Подсчитать...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ru